How to choose the best dog insurance company

Pets

You never know what is going to happen to your dog. If you have to take him to an expensive vet, he’ll be glad you had the foresight to get insurance. Here are some things to keep in mind when trying to find the best dog insurance company.

Experience

First, you’ll want to see how long the company has been in business. As with most things, the more experienced the company, the better. However, this is not always the case, as the larger companies are not always the best option.

license

Before looking at anything, you need to make sure the company is licensed to do business in your state. You may want to think about the future as well. If you ever plan to move and take your dog with you, the company will also need to be licensed in that state.

cost

Of course, you’ll definitely want to take a look at the costs of getting insurance for your dog. It goes without saying that the cheapest plans are not always the way to go. On the contrary, he may not necessarily need the most expensive plan on the market either. Consider your dog’s situation and his budget. As with other types of insurance, be prepared for premium increases in the future as well. They will increase especially as your dog gets older.

When looking at the fine details of your dog’s insurance policy, be sure to pay attention to the payment limit. This is the maximum amount the company will pay for any one claim. If you have a $1,000 payment limit and a $4,500 vet bill, you’ll need to make up the difference.

discounts

The best dog insurance company will offer discounts of some kind. One of the most common is for owners of multiple pets. If you cover them all with one company, you could save quite a bit of money.

Claim (is

When looking to get insurance for your dog, be sure to consider the claims process. You want it to go as smooth as possible. Some companies require that you pay the vet the entire bill and then wait for your money to be returned.

Others have the vet fill out forms as part of the claim process. Insurance companies sometimes restrict the vet you can take your dog to. If you take it to one that is out of network, you will have to pay a higher cost.

Welfare

You don’t just need to go to the vet when there’s something wrong. Your dog needs to see the vet at least once a year for a wellness exam anyway. Since this is highly recommended, look for a dog insurance policy that covers preventive care. May not cover all areas, such as dental cleanings, vaccinations, and heartworm medications.

Having insurance for your dog would certainly come in handy if something big unexpectedly came up. If you decide to hire him, then keep these tips in mind so you can find the best dog insurance company.
